Hibiscus Hymns

Hear these hibiscus hymns
Colorful souls fragrant breeze
Like song in nose in ears swim
Delightful gold melodies

Lovely ballet of blue butterflies 
Wings that flutter around flowers
The beauty against summer skies
Daydreaming in the garden for hours

Hearts that seek a healthy retreat 
Find a bench to sit and reflect
Listen to red birds happily tweet 
As squirrels scamper nature respects 

Crab grass seems to add a note
As bare feet walk so leisurely 
Like green symphony with tan toes
Tall trees with leaves that sing

Hibiscus hymns are inside all
Who open heart and pray
Breaking down imagined wall
Seeing nature and man embraced
